Another Etsy Maine Team Promotion

Because we were in the spirit of giving, the Etsy Maine Team will be donating 15% of all sales from participating seller's shops from 11/13 to 11/19 to Preble Street, a local homeless shelter.

Preble Street is a Maine organization which provides accessible barrier-free services to empower people experiencing problems with homelessness, housing, hunger, and poverty; and advocates for solutions to these problems. Watch their PSA here: http://www.preblestreet.org/home_for_good_video1.php

Help keep Maine women, men, children, and teens warm and empowered this winter!
